i dont think this is possible as it would pose a BIG security risk, being able to execute and command a massive subsystem like IIS or PWS to do what it likes!!

Can't u just store the site as the HTML (or whatever) documents on the CD and make an autorun.inf pointing to the appropiate file (index.htm).

If you're thinking about running dynamic scripts like PHP and ASP on the client machine then forget it -- there's no way a CD could be inserted which could activate IIS, configure the CD drive for dynamic content and display it on the PC just like that -- not without VERY complex programming at least and even then, it would be very limited to the machines it would run on.
